Did you heard of black tea? No, I don’t mean drinking, I mean soaking your hands and feet in it. People claim that it works. The tannic acid inside of tea is known to block certain sweat glands. The tannic acid solution in tea worked a little bit for me as well. Simply heat up a large amount of it, the blacker the better (2 tea bags is fine). Wait until the water becomes luke warm, use some cold water to speed up the process. Soak your hands or feet in it for 30 minutes. Afterwards drink the tea. Just kidding you can donate it to the sewers. The initial tea treatment should be last one week and performed daily. You can do it for 2 days in the subsequent weeks. Make sure to wash the feet with soap and thoroughly clean them of any tea stains. Rub your feet with pumice stone to diminish the number of calluses (which often retain the stains). People suffering from sweaty feet should befriend a good antibacterial soap.
It is the bacteria on the soles of your feet that cause the bad odor. A strong bacteria killing soap is needed to help you fight the smell. Your feet is like the perfect breeding ground for bacteria. Bacteria start multiplying in large number when it’s dark and wet. If you wear synthetic socks then you will attract even more bacteria. They will soak in the moisture. Wear cotton socks. Cotton material is good because of it forces the sweat away from the skin. Some people become so desperate with the sweating feet and the smell that they have them surgically removed.
You can do a number of things on those pesky glands. You can cut, clamp or even burn them away, but there are certain risks involved with this procedure. You can’t really predict how your body will react, so this is not the ideal answer to how to stop sweating. Often times you see compensation sweat develop in a different part of your body. For example, after the procedure, you might see more sweat in the groin area as opposed to your hands. This solution is used to treat very severe cases of sweating feet hyperhidrosis, you should really think carefully about it. Consult your physician first before making the decision.
Another drastic approach is to use electricity to treat sweat. Sounds like something out of a Sci-Fi movie, right? This solution was patented by the Drionic brand. It’s a method that’s supposed to block the sweat glands for a certain time. The time frame depends on how thick your skin is and how your body conducts electricity. But don’t be fooled. No matter how futuristic this method sounds it’s still temporary and is not guaranteed to work. I’m sure you can find something less painful and just as effective.
